Questions about Snow Flurry

  • What type of living environment is this breed usually best suited for?

    Domestic Short Hair cats are highly adaptable and do well in a variety of homes, ranging from apartments to houses. They thrive most in environments where they receive attention and enrichment.

  • How much outdoor space does this breed typically need?

    Domestic Short Hair cats do not require outdoor space and often flourish living entirely indoors, where they are safe from outdoor hazards. Window perches and interactive toys can help satisfy their curiosity.

  • Is this breed typically suitable for homes with children?

    Domestic Short Hairs are usually excellent family pets and are known for their friendly and tolerant nature with children, especially when properly socialized.
